My God, Thank You For Making a Hedge Around Me
April 20 Scripture Meditations Based on Job 1-6
Key Verse – Job 1:10 Hast not thou made an hedge about him, and about his house, and about all that he hath on every side? thou hast blessed the work of his hands, and his substance is increased in the land.
MY GOD, THANK YOU FOR MAKING A HEDGE AROUND ME
Thank You for making a hedge around me and my soul
Along Your sovereignty’s pole
Upon Your supreme authority’s role…
Thus, I’m settled toward Your heavenly goal.
Thank You for making a hedge around me and my heart
Along Your compassion right from the start
Upon Your loving kindness that does not depart…
Thus, I’m protected from hatred-bitterness’ dart.
Thank You for making a hedge around me and my spirit
Along Your salvation far from hell’s destruction-pit
Upon Your eternal life’s record-writ declaring me divinely fit…
Thus, I’m assured by Your truth’s wit against everlasting split.
Thank You for making a hedge around me and my mind
Along Your Word where my well-being is designed
Upon Your immutability securing my commitment-bind…
Thus, I’m guarded against doubts and folly causing me to be fatally blind.
Thank You for making a hedge around me and my conviction
Along Your standard for my decision’s direction
Upon Your precepts’ instruction…
Thus, I’m guided in my service-function.
Thank You for making a hedge around me and my faith-productiveness
Along Your power of miracles’ blessedness
Upon Your ways full of impossibilities’ worthiness…
Thus, I’m geared for stewardship-effectiveness.
